Yanqing District once known as Yanqing County is northwest of Beijing. Before 2015, it was a county. Now, it is a district of the municipality of Beijing. It is about 74km away from the city center. Yanqing District borders Huairou and Changping. These are Beijing districts. It also borders Huailai and Chicheng. These are Hebei counties. Yanqing hosted the Expo 2019. It also hosted the 2022 Winter Olympics. Alpine skiing took place here. Bobsled, luge, and skeleton events were also held here.

In the Tang Dynasty, Guichuan County was established. It belonged to the Gui Prefecture in Hebei. It had a defensive military city. In 1952, it was reassigned to the Zhangjiakou Special Zone in Hebei Province. In 1958, it was transferred to Beijing. In November 2015, Yanqing County was abolished. It was established as a district. Yanqing District became sister cities with Dongdaemun District in Seoul in 1997. They signed a cultural and sports exchange agreement. They also signed an economic exchange agreement in 2011.

Yanqing has a continental monsoon climate. It is a transitional zone. It lies between temperate and mid-temperate zones. It is a semi-arid and semi-humid zone. Yanqing is known as Beijing’s summer capital. The average annual temperature is 9.6 °C. The district has abundant solar energy resources. Yanqing’s wind resources account for 70% of Beijing.

The Yanqing Badaling Great Wall Basin is surrounded by mountains. It is surrounded on three sides. These are the north, south, and east. The Guanting Reservoir is to the west. Haituo Mountain is the highest peak in the territory. Its elevation is 2241 meters. It is the second highest peak in Beijing.

Yanqing is rich in geothermal, solar, and wind energy. These are new and renewable energy sources. They account for 25% of energy consumption. Yanqing is one of the first national green energy demonstration counties. It is a new and renewable energy demonstration area in Beijing.
